Handover — Drone Servicing

Marta, the Skylark V2 unit from the Brenwick survey team came back this morning with a cracked gimbal mount. Battery removed and stored separately per policy. Service ticket is open; Corvid Repairs will collect tomorrow between 9 and 11. Paperwork is in the grey folder on the dispatch shelf. The confidential hand-over instruction for the courier is below.

handover note for yagef-bagep: the drudor pelius courier leaves the kasdor zorvan norir ledger at gate 8016 under passcode 755406

Requests must include the affected pipelines, expected run-window impact, and a rollback plan. Approvals during a release freeze need an explicit exception ticket. Minor config changes (retry counts, alert thresholds) may be self-approved by the owner; schema-affecting or window-shifting changes may not. Final sign-off authority for every Duskrunner change rests with the person named below.

named custodian: Belius Casath Ulaix Sorius

Subject: Kiosk watchdog changes — read before deploying

Team — short version for new folks. The Ordwell kiosk app runs a watchdog that restarts the UI if the heartbeat stalls past 20 seconds. Release 4.2 moves the watchdog out of the app process into a supervisor daemon, so a frozen renderer can't block its own restart. Do not deploy 4.2 to stores still on firmware 7; the daemon won't start. Verify the supervisor version on each unit before rollout. The reference build token is below.

pipeline stamp: htk31_f769b577b3028a4e9958e5bb8d1259a